Shedding Some Light (Literally) on Sunshine Hours

Let's be honest, who wants a vacation filled with gloomy skies? Thankfully, Florida in November boasts an abundance of sunshine. We're talking 7 to 9 hours a day, on average, which is basically a beach bum's dream come true. So yeah, ditch the umbrella (unless you're using it for shade) and pack those sunglasses!

Temperature Tango: From Sunshine to Snuggles

November in Florida is like that sweet spot in a rom-com: not too hot, not too cold. Average highs hover around a delightful 26°C (79°F), perfect for chilling by the pool or exploring the outdoors without melting into a puddle. Evenings dip down to a cool 18°C (64°F), making it sweater weather with a tropical twist.

Now, Florida's a big state, and temperatures can vary slightly depending on where you're headed. The northern regions tend to be a tad cooler, with highs reaching around 24°C (75°F). Meanwhile, the southern charm of Miami and the Keys basks in slightly warmer temperatures, with highs averaging a luxurious 27°C (80°F).

Rain, Rain, Go Away (Mostly)

Remember those afternoon summer showers Florida is famous for? Thankfully, November marks the beginning of the dry season. You can expect some rain, but it'll likely be scattered showers, not a complete downpour. Pack a light rain jacket just in case, but don't let the threat of a sprinkle ruin your poolside paradise.

Hurricane Season? Don't Sweat It

Hurricane season in Florida typically wraps up by the end of October. So, while there's always a chance of unpredictable weather, November is generally a safe bet when it comes to avoiding tropical storms.
